UT54ACS132E - Quadruple 2-Input NAND Schmitt Triggers

General Description

The UT54ACS132 is a quadruple 2-input NAND gate with Schmitt Trigger input levels.

A high applied on both the inputs forces the output to a low state.

The devices are characterized over full HiRel temperature range of -55°C to +125°C.

Key Features

  • 0.6μm CRH CMOS Process - Latchup immune.
  • High speed.
  • Low power consumption.
  • Wide operating power supply from 3.0V to 5.5V.
  • Available QML Q or V processes.
  • 14-lead flatpack.
